Citable company snapshot
Verisk Analytics, Inc.'s latest SEC-sourced 2026-03-31 period shows $782.60M in revenue and $234.20M in net income.
| Metric | Latest period | Latest value | Prior value | YoY |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| xbrl:RevenueFromContractWithCustomerExcludingAssessedTax | Mar 31, 2026 | $782.60M | $778.80M | +0.5% |
| xbrl:OperatingIncomeLoss | Mar 31, 2026 | $352.20M | $313.60M | +12.3% |
| xbrl:NetIncomeLoss | Mar 31, 2026 | $234.20M | $197.20M | +18.8% |
| xbrl:NetCashProvidedByUsedInOperatingActivities | Mar 31, 2026 | $390.40M | $343.30M | +13.7% |
| Free Cash Flow (computed) | Mar 31, 2026 | $326.40M | $276.10M | +18.2% |
Source: SEC EDGAR XBRL; period Mar 31, 2026; filed Apr 29, 2026; accession 0001437749-26-013729.
